Solution for -7x+3=1+2-6x+2x equation:



-7x+3=1+2-6x+2x
We move all terms to the left:
-7x+3-(1+2-6x+2x)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-7x-(-4x+3)+3=0
We get rid of parentheses
-7x+4x-3+3=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-3x=0
x=0/-3
x=0
